ON RUNNING seeks a Lead - Technical Representatives in Greater London, responsible for driving strategic growth and execution of grassroots education initiatives. The ideal candidate will empower a team to provide exceptional service to wholesale partners, supported by 6+ years of experience in technical representation or related fields.
This role requires advanced communication skills and proficiency in project management tools. The position involves up to 60% travel and reinforces ON RUNNING's premium brand positioning.
